-     SCENARIO("Vector resizing affects size and capacity", "[vector][bdd][size][capacity]") {
 
-         GIVEN("an empty vector") {
 
-             std::vector<int> v;
 
-             REQUIRE(v.size() == 0);
 
-             WHEN("it is made larger") {
 
-                 v.resize(10);
 
-                 THEN("the size and capacity go up") {
 
-                     REQUIRE(v.size() == 10);
 
-                     REQUIRE(v.capacity() >= 10);
 
-                     AND_WHEN("it is made smaller again") {
 
-                         v.resize(5);
 
-                         THEN("the size goes down but the capacity stays the same") {
 
-                             REQUIRE(v.size() == 5);
 
-                             REQUIRE(v.capacity() >= 10);
 
-                         }
 
-                     }
 
-                 }
 
-             }
 
-             WHEN("we reserve more space") {
 
-                 v.reserve(10);
 
-                 THEN("The capacity is increased but the size remains the same") {
 
-                     REQUIRE(v.capacity() >= 10);
 
-                     REQUIRE(v.size() == 0);
 
-                 }
 
-             }
 
-         }
 
-     }
